Find the volume of the cone to the nearest whole number. Radius is 2 and height is 4

Respuesta :

bhuvna789456
bhuvna789456 bhuvna789456
  • 04-03-2020

Volume of the cone is 17 cm³

Step-by-step explanation:

  • Step 1: Volume of a cone = 1/3 πr²h. Find volume of the cone where r = 2 inches and h = 4 cm.

Volume = 1/3 × 3.14 × 2² × 4

             = 16.75 cm³ ≈ 17 cm³ (rounding off to nearest whole number)
